The Telomere Effect- Live Longer, Live Better



We all want to be healthier and live longer, better lives... right? Nobel Prize Winner Elizabeth Blackburn and Elissa Epel have written The Telomere Effect to help us head in the right direction, focusing on one of the most smallest and most important parts of our bodies: telomeres. 

I'm not going to give a big long scientific lecture about what telomeres are. I thought the authors did a great job explaining them to the common person, but I have to say I did think they went a little light on their explanation. Anyway, telomeres are basically the caps on the ends of our chromosomes that have shown to be directly related to health: the longer your telomeres, the longer you remain in the "healthy" zone of your life and thrive. Telomeres shorten after every cellular division and help determine how fast our cells age and eventually die- the authors use the analogy of the little plastic caps on the end of our shoe laces. So the more you can do to protect your telomeres, the longer they will remain, and, theoretically, the healthier you will stay (obviously there are a lot of exceptions, but you can read the book for those).

So, how do we keep our telomeres from shortening prematurely, and even lengthen them (they can get longer!  Telomere health can be improved!)? There are many, many things, but here are the major categories:

1. Eat healthily: less processed food and red meat, more omega-3s and plants

2. Sleep: Quality of sleep is incredibly important for our bodies to heal and recharge

3. Exercise: Cardiovascular activity most days for thirty minutes is one of the most important things you can do for your telomeres. A variety of activity helps, as well. 

4. Educate yourself: Those that have gone to college have longer telomeres (as do their children).

5. Manage stress: Ongoing, long-term stress does a ridiculous amount of harm to your telomeres

6. Foster relationships: Having people who you are close to lengthens telomeres. Weekly sex has substantial benefits as well (just saying what the science says).

7. Avoid chemical exposure: Be mindful of where you live and products you use in your home.

The book also spends some time discussing the role childhood trauma can have on telomere length, the genetic aspects of the process (telomere length starts in the womb), and positive thinking.

When Breath Becomes Air

I don't tend to do whole posts centered on just one book, but I do make exceptions, most often for nonfiction works. When Breath Becomes Air, by Paul Kalanithi, is such one. I read this unfinished memoir in less than a day, sucked in by his cerebral, yet lovely, prose, his philosophical pondering, and his story in general.

For those unfamiliar with this bestseller, Kalanithi was a relatively young, brilliant, neurosurgeon at Stanford who was diagnosed with stage 4 lung cancer. He wrestled with careers in literature and science as a college student (while I wasn't even a fraction as intelligent as he, I did feel he was a kindred spirit in this sense, since I also faced this debate) and ultimately medicine won. He was incredibly bright and successful, although his description of his own accolades I found modest and humble. The first half of his part of the book is devoted to his background, giving us context for how he handles his diagnosis and course of treatment. I felt that even though brief, this part of the book gave me a decent picture of the man- one that I'd like to be friends or have as my own doctor (god forbid I even need a neurosurgeon). 

During the second section, the reader is already in awe of Kalanithi as a person, medical professional, and scientist. I was deeply affected reading his musings on life and death, and feeling conflict as he wrestled with his treatment options and whether or not he and his wife Lucy should have a baby with the sperm they proactively froze when they learned he had cancer. Death on one level is so simple and natural, but that's just biologically. Cells die. It's what they do. When human emotions and familial bonds are brought into play death becomes one of the most complex human events possible. 

The idea of knowledge is paramount to this book. Knowledge is power, so they say, but it can complicate matters profusely. At one point Kalanithi's oncologist tells him, gently, that whenever he is ready to let her be the doctor and allow himself to be the patient, she can make it happen. Having the information he has as an expertly trained physician proves to often be incredibly helpful, but it also makes the process of battling the disease more challenging as well. Doctoring oneself is no small task. 

Kalanithi loses his battle quicker than I anticipated, and his accounts of how much he suffered (before he stopped writing) were heart-breaking. His wife Lucy takes up the third portion of the book, writing about his final days and how she started coping once he did pass. Her descriptions of his final days and his interactions with their baby brought me to tears, which rarely happens when I read.

Nonfiction Nagging- Gulp

These past few weeks I have been slowly, yet enthusiastically, reading science writer Mary Roach's book Gulp: Adventures on the Alimentary Canal. Yup. I just willingly read an entire book on the digestive system, and I loved it.

Roach's book is broken up into seventeen sections, each tackling one of the oddities of food intake. For example, there's a chapter dedicated to how pet food is created to be pleasing to animals. There's another on a man who had a hole in his stomach, which allowed his physician to study what happened internally. You can learn about what exactly you can stuff up your -ahem- butt, just in case you ever find yourself in prison (and want to smuggle in cell phones! That's all I meant, I promise) or forced into becoming an international drug mule (yet have we learned nothing from Orange in the New Black?). You will also learn about the noses of professional sniffers, including those that make up those wonderful descriptions of wine (you know, the ones that compare a Chardonnay to "a fresh cut lawn strewn with strawberries in March of 2011, just after a raccoon with wet paws has walked across it"). Constipation is discussed. So is saliva. All the gross stuff. 

Yet, none of it really seems gross, or boring, for that matter. And Lord knows there's potential, on both ends (badumdumdum). Roach is incredibly skilled, though, both in constructing her actual prose, but also in determining how far to take her subject. She's humorous, intelligent, and has a quick, biting wit. Nonfiction Nagging- The Immortal Life of Henrietta Lacks

I'm really not sure what took my so long to read Rebecca Skloot's The Immortal Life of Henrietta Lacks, but I'm thrilled that I finally have. For me this book married two of my most favorite things: biology and narrative (it is a true story, but it reads with the fluidity of a novel). Skloot traces the famous HeLa cells ("immortal" cells from patient Henrietta Lacks that have been used to study countless diseases and create many cures) back to their origins, investigating the treatment of the original patient and those connected to her since then. The research the cells have allowed has prompted developments as essential as the polio vaccine, cloning, and gene mapping- they've directly and indirectly saved many lives. The resounding ethical question: was it right for doctors to take her cells without permission?

Structure
Skloot structures this text so that the reader is constantly being moved from Henrietta Lack's past to the author's investigation in the present. As we're finding out about Lacks and her illness, death, and the usage of her cells, we're also learning about her family and how the exploitation of her cells have impacted their lives. This book is an incredibly quick read, in part due to the overall flow.

The three sections of the book are entitled "Life, "Death," and "Immortality," which parallel Lacks' existence. This process is also something that her surviving family members must deal with as well; coping with loss is difficult, but not being able to obtain true closure complicates matters even more.

Ethics
The ethical implication behind Henrietta Lacks' story are incredible. She was a poor, black woman with STDs and cancer in the 1950s- there was absolutely no regard whatsoever for patient choice. Researchers took her cells and once it was determined that they rapidly replicated they were eventually sold to labs around the world, the Lacks family seeing none of the profit, adding to the dilemma. Race compounds the issue, Skloot adding in additional research on other controversial policies during the time period. While legislation offers more protection now, what does that mean for the Lacks family? Is it okay for doctors to make exceptions to help thousands of others and advance medical science? How should patients be compensated when their medical records are used and generate profit? And who pays whom? It's a really complicated, emotionally charged debate that's simultaneously fascinating and mind-boggling.
